package util
import (
"encoding/binary"
"fmt"
"github.com/golang/snappy"
"io"
"math"
"github.com/vmihailenco/msgpack"
)
const (
MessageEOF = math.MinInt32
BufferSize = 1024 * 512
)
func CopyBuffer(src io.Reader, dst io.Writer) (err error) {
buf := make([]byte, BufferSize)
for {
nr, er := src.Read(buf)
if nr > 0 {
nw, ew := dst.Write(buf[0:nr])
if ew != nil {
err = ew
break
}
if nr != nw {
err = io.ErrShortWrite
break
}
}
if er != nil {
err = er
break
}
}
return err
}
func ReadMessage(reader io.Reader) (res []byte, err error) {
var length int32
err = binary.Read(reader, binary.LittleEndian, &length)
if err == io.EOF || length == MessageEOF {
return nil, io.EOF
}
if err != nil {
return nil, err
}
if length == 0 {
return nil, nil
}
res = make([]byte, length)
var n int
n, err = io.ReadFull(reader, res)
if err == io.EOF {
return nil, fmt.Errorf("unexpected EOF when reading message, expected read %v, only read %v", length, n)
}
if err != nil {
return nil, err
}
buf, err := snappy.Decode(nil, res)
if err != nil {
return nil, err
}
return buf, nil
}
func WriteMessage(writer io.Writer, msg []byte) (err error) {
buf := snappy.Encode(nil, msg)
if err = binary.Write(writer, binary.LittleEndian, int32(len(buf))); err != nil {
return err
}
if _, err = writer.Write(buf); err != nil {
return err
}
return nil
}
func WriteEOFMessage(writer io.Writer) (err error) {
if err = binary.Write(writer, binary.LittleEndian, int32(MessageEOF)); err != nil {
return err
}
return nil
}
func ReadObject(reader io.Reader, obj interface{}) error {
msg, err := ReadMessage(reader)
if err != nil {
return err
}
err = msgpack.Unmarshal(msg, obj)
return err
}
func WriteObject(writer io.Writer, obj interface{}) error {
buf, err := msgpack.Marshal(obj)
if err != nil {
return err
}
return WriteMessage(writer, buf)
}
